Up Dos for I Dos vs. Nicole Palermo vs. a salon near Towson?

Anyone know what would be better? I'm trying to figure out hair/makeup and I don't know if I should go to a salon or not. Up Dos for I Dos seems pretty good for hair but I'm not so sure for makeup. Is Nicole Palermo better or are they comparable? Is there some awesome salon that I should look into?

    Both Nicole and Up Dos get great reviews on here - so I'm not sure that one would be "better" in the end than the other.  I think it depends on your personal style and what look you're going for. 

    As far as salon vs. someone that will come to you, I have to agree with pp and say that hands down, it is so nice to have someone come to you.  There are so many variables on your wedding day and removing any that you can is definitely worthwhile.  I was lucky and my mom is a hairdresser, so I got to sit back in my hotel room and get ready at my leisure.  I definitely would not have wanted to be rushing around town to appointments.  That being said, I know tons of girls do it and it works out well.  Ask yourself what you want for your day and that is the way to go!

    I agree with kimbrout - having someone come to you is best way to go (IMO).  It takes away one more stressor and you don't have to worry about driving somewhere, running late...etc.  I used the person that typically cuts my hair for my hair and she came to us (with another girl) and did everyone's hair at the hotel.  It was relaxing and fun.

    We also used Up Dos for makeup and couldn't have been happier.  I've used Nicole in the past and she's fabulous too.  Price wise - they're comparable.
